Partly granted

The Veteran's claim for service connection for tinnitus has been reopened, and the Board finds that service connection is warranted.,Service connection was denied for bilateral hearing loss. The Board found no evidence of a chronic disease in service or within a presumptive period.

The deciding factor: The preponderance of the evidence does not support a finding that the Veteran's current hearing loss disability is related to his military service, as there were no complaints or treatment for hearing loss during service and post-service audiograms showed normal hearing.
